Report Key Statistics

The foundation of the WiseGuy Reports analysis provides crucial context for understanding the competitive dynamics among bacteriological testing manufacturers. The global market was valued at 4.83 billion USD in 2024, setting a robust baseline for the projected growth. The report forecasts a steady CAGR of 4.9% from 2026 to 2035, culminating in a market worth 8.2 billion USD by 2035. The competitive landscape is shaped by regional variations, with North America holding the largest share at 1.8 billion USD in 2024, driven by advanced healthcare infrastructure. The Asia-Pacific region is expected to witness the highest growth rate. Key companies profiled in the report include Siemens Healthineers, Merck KGaA, Thermo Fisher Scientific, Danaher Corporation, bioMérieux, Luminex Corporation, BD, Fujifilm Holdings, Hach, PerkinElmer, Roche Diagnostics, Abbott Laboratories, Agilent Technologies, Quest Diagnostics, and Charles River Laboratories.

Industry Trends

Several key trends are shaping the strategies of leading bacteriological testing manufacturers. The increasing demand for rapid and accurate molecular diagnostic solutions is a primary driver, prompting manufacturers to invest in PCR, next-generation sequencing, and other advanced technologies. There is a significant focus on developing automated and high-throughput platforms to improve laboratory efficiency and reduce turnaround times. Manufacturers are responding to the demand for integrated workflow solutions that streamline testing from sample preparation to result reporting. The shift towards decentralization and point-of-care testing is leading to the development of portable and user-friendly testing kits. Furthermore, the integration of AI and data analytics to predict outbreaks and interpret complex data is becoming a key differentiator.

Challenges

Despite the positive growth trajectory, bacteriological testing manufacturers face significant challenges. The high cost of research and development required to create advanced diagnostic platforms and reagents can be substantial. This is compounded by the need to navigate complex and evolving regulatory pathways for product approval in different regions. Supply chain vulnerabilities for specialized materials and components can impact production. The need to provide comprehensive training and technical support for increasingly sophisticated instruments presents operational challenges. Intense competition requires manufacturers to continuously innovate and differentiate their offerings while managing costs.
